Montana hikeing tours are never complete without a trip to White Base Camp. This is a favorite destination among excited tourists. If you’re also up for horse riding, wranglers could introduce you to safe horsemanship and lend you your very own gentle and trained horse for the tour. To start the hiking tour, you’ll cross the both the South Fork and the West Fork pack bridges of the beautiful Sun River first thing in the morning. You can enjoy the soothing sound of streaming water when you have lunch at one of the creeks in the vicinity. After a period of rest, the hike continues all the way up to Indian Creek, an especially scenic area where you can see bears feeding on berry crops and mountain goats running along the green pasture. The hike reaches its climax at no less than the top of the majestic Continental Divide.

Montana hiking tours are not limited to a visit to White Base Camp. There are many other stations where grand adventures can begin, such as the Chinese Wall, Prairie Reef, Flathead, Wendover Ridge, and the famous Glacier-Waterton – trips that are sure to give you and your family wonderful memories.
